Transaction 61e1253a02238d8212bb9ec3afd3a3796bc1024ded69a9b4e2656e55a2c312e8

1 Input
2 Outputs
  • 61e1253a02238d8212bb9ec3afd3a3796bc1024ded69a9b4e2656e55a2c312e8:0
  • value  14079000
    address  1PENbsfpeSBoR7Qwk5D9ypHdTKgMDBxXHh
  • 61e1253a02238d8212bb9ec3afd3a3796bc1024ded69a9b4e2656e55a2c312e8:1
  • value  1454455436
    address  1KaAB92nv8PFp2g3ANymCKqvCQkkgBPAP